Latest Patents
Durocher holds a patent for a Variable Vane Actuating System. This invention features a variable vane assembly designed for gas turbine engines. The actuating system includes a rotatable face gear and respective pinions that extend transversely from the ends of the movable vanes. The design incorporates unique land surfaces on the pinion teeth that are angled in relation to those of the face gear, allowing for precise control of the backlash in the system. This innovation also discusses methods for adjusting angular variance in the actuating system, which is crucial for optimizing engine performance.
